Metsäliitto Cooperative

Metsäliitto Cooperative, the parent company of Metsä Group, is owned by forest owners in Finland. After paying their statutory shares, members can increase their ownership by investing in additional Metsä1 shares.

The cooperative pays annual interest on these shares, and its profit-sharing model rewards members who actively trade wood with the group. This allows forests to keep generating value long after harvesting.

Since 2022, part of Metsäliitto’s profits has been distributed as additional Metsä1 shares, based on each member’s wood deliveries over the previous four years.
